Emilio Lustau grew out of a family vineyard south of Jerez de la Frontera, where José Ruiz-Berdejo began aging wine as an almacenista, a small-scale producer supplying larger Sherry houses, back in 1896. His descendants carried the business into Jerez proper and eventually launched it under the Lustau name in the mid-twentieth century, expanding into exports by the 1950s. A 1990 merger with the Luis Caballero Group gave the house the resources to grow further, and Lustau remains a benchmark producer across the full range of Sherry styles.

Don Nuño is an Oloroso, a style built on oxidative rather than biological aging. Unlike Manzanilla or Fino, this wine is fortified to a higher alcohol level early on, which discourages the growth of flor and allows the wine to develop instead through slow contact with air inside the cask. It moves through Lustau's solera system in American oak, reaching an average age of around twelve years before bottling, a process that concentrates its color and deepens its nutty, oxidative character.

This Oloroso pours a dark bronze with a golden rim. The nose is pungent and nutty, backed by a smoky wood note, while the palate delivers bitter chocolate, walnut, and baked chestnut flavors with a tangy, cutting acidity beneath the richness. Serve it slightly chilled alongside aged cheeses, red meat, game, or hearty stews.
